Short version

Durak is an offline card game. There are no user accounts and the game never asks for your name, e-mail or phone number. Your progress, statistics and settings are stored only on your device.

The app does use three Google services, and they receive some data from your device: Google AdMob (advertising), Google Analytics for Firebase (anonymous usage statistics and crash reports) and, if you choose to sign in, Google Play Games Services (achievements and leaderboards). The sections below describe exactly what each one receives and how you can limit it.

Data that stays on your device

Your nickname (a randomly generated one, editable by you), avatar, coin and credit balances, rating, statistics, achievements and settings are kept in the app's private storage on your phone. They are included in Android's standard app backup if you have backup enabled, and are deleted when you uninstall the app or use Settings → Reset progress.

Advertising (Google AdMob)

The game shows interstitial ads between games, an optional rewarded ad that you start yourself to earn coins, and an app-open ad when you return to the game. Ads are delivered by Google AdMob. To request and measure ads, Google collects the device's resettable advertising ID, IP address, approximate location derived from it, device model, operating system version and information about ad interactions. This is described in How Google uses information from sites or apps that use its services and the Google Privacy Policy.

Users in the EEA, the UK and Switzerland are shown a consent form on first launch (Google's certified consent management platform). You can change your choice at any time in Settings → Ad & privacy options. If you decline, you will still see ads, but they will not be personalised. Everyone can also reset or delete the advertising ID in Android settings (Settings → Google → Ads), which limits ad personalisation.

Analytics and crash reports (Google Analytics for Firebase, Firebase Crashlytics)

To understand which screens are used, how long games last and where the app crashes, the app sends anonymous usage events and crash reports to Firebase. This includes a random installation identifier generated by the app, the device model, OS version, app version, language, country (derived from IP), and in-game events such as "game started", "game ended", "ad shown". No name, e-mail or contact data is involved. Analytics data is retained by Google for up to 14 months. Details: Privacy and Security in Firebase.

In the EEA, the UK and Switzerland analytics storage is switched on only after you consent in the same form used for advertising (Google Consent Mode).

Google Play Games Services (optional)

If your device has a Google Play Games profile, the game can unlock your achievements and post your rating to the Play Games leaderboards. Google then processes your Play Games player ID and the scores under the Google Privacy Policy. This is optional: you can decline the Play Games sign-in prompt, and the game keeps all achievements locally instead.

Notifications

The app can remind you when your daily bonus is ready or when you have not played for a while. These reminders are scheduled locally on your phone; no server is involved. The app may also receive occasional news through Firebase Cloud Messaging, which uses a device token issued by Google. You can decline the notification permission or disable notifications in system settings at any time; the game works exactly the same without them.

Permissions

PermissionWhy
INTERNET, ACCESS_NETWORK_STATE Required by the advertising, analytics and messaging libraries. The game itself sends no data.
POST_NOTIFICATIONS Local reminders and news notifications. Optional.
RECEIVE_BOOT_COMPLETED Re-schedules local reminders after the phone restarts.
VIBRATE Short haptic feedback when it is your turn. Can be switched off in settings.
com.google.android.gms.permission.AD_ID Declared by the Google Mobile Ads library to read the resettable advertising ID.

Children

The game is not directed at children under 13 and does not knowingly collect personal information from them. It contains no real-money gambling; coins and credits have no monetary value and cannot be bought or cashed out.
